The Importance of Due Diligence for New Platforms
Why Due Diligence is Paramount
- Protection Against Scams and Fraud: The internet is unfortunately rife with fraudulent websites designed to phish for personal information, distribute malware, or conduct financial scams. A legitimate, transparent website is the first line of defense.
- Statistic: According to the Federal Trade Commission FTC, consumers reported losing nearly $10 billion to scams in 2023, a significant portion of which originated online. Source: FTC.gov
- Ensuring Data Privacy and Security: When you provide personal information, you’re trusting the platform with your data. A legitimate site will have robust security measures e.g., strong encryption, data protection protocols and a clear privacy policy. An unlaunched site provides no such assurances.
- Data Point: A 2023 IBM study on data breaches found the average cost of a data breach globally was $4.45 million, highlighting the severe consequences of inadequate security. Source: IBM.com
- Verifying Service Legitimacy and Quality: Beyond scams, some platforms may simply offer low-quality or ineffective services. Due diligence helps you assess the expertise, track record, and capabilities of the provider.
- Avoiding Ethical Compromises: For individuals and businesses adhering to specific ethical guidelines like Islamic finance, due diligence is essential to ensure the service provider’s practices align with those principles. This includes checking for transparency, absence of interest riba, and engagement in ethical business conduct.
Key Due Diligence Steps for Any Online Platform
When evaluating a new website once it actually launches:
- Check for an “About Us” Page: This should clearly state the company’s mission, history, and the qualifications of its leadership team.
- Look for Contact Information: A legitimate business will provide clear ways to contact them: phone numbers, email addresses, and ideally a physical address.
- Review Terms of Service and Privacy Policy: These documents should be easily accessible, comprehensive, and clear about how your data will be used and what your rights are.
- Verify Professional Certifications/Licenses: For services like tax preparation or financial advisory, ensure the professionals are licensed and regulated by relevant authorities e.g., IRS Enrolled Agents, CPAs, CFPs.
- Seek Independent Reviews: Don’t just rely on testimonials on the site. Look for reviews on third-party platforms e.g., Trustpilot, Google Reviews, BBB.
- Assess Website Security: Always ensure the site uses HTTPS. Check for secure payment gateways if transactions are involved.
- Evaluate Content Quality: Is the information well-written, accurate, and professional? Grammatical errors and poorly structured content can be red flags.
- Understand Pricing Transparency: Are all costs clearly laid out? Are there any hidden fees?

The Ethical Lens: Assessing Financial Service Websites
When evaluating any financial service website, an ethical lens is not just a nice-to-have. it’s a fundamental necessity, especially for those who adhere to specific moral or religious principles, such as Islamic ethics. For a site like Integritax.biz, which currently offers no content, this assessment is impossible, but it highlights the critical questions one should ask once it or any similar site eventually launches.
Core Ethical Considerations for Financial Services

- What to look for: Does the website clearly explain its services, fees, and terms? Is information easily accessible, or is it hidden in fine print? Are there any misleading claims or exaggerated promises?
- Islamic Principle: This aligns with the prohibition of gharar excessive uncertainty or ambiguity and the emphasis on clear, honest dealings.
- Data Point: A 2022 survey by PwC found that 87% of consumers believe transparency is more important than ever when choosing a brand. Source: PwC.com
-
Fairness and Justice:
- What to look for: Are the pricing structures equitable? Do they exploit vulnerable individuals? Do they promote fair trade practices? Are their internal operations ethical e.g., employee treatment?
- Islamic Principle: Rooted in the principles of ‘adl justice and ihsan excellence, which demand fair treatment for all parties and avoidance of exploitation.
-
Avoidance of Harmful Practices:
- What to look for: Does the service promote or facilitate activities considered unethical or harmful? This includes direct involvement or indirect support.
- Islamic Principle: Strict prohibition of riba interest/usury, maysir gambling/speculation, and the financing of haram forbidden activities e.g., alcohol, illicit drugs, pornography, weapons of mass destruction.
- Real-world application: For a tax service, this might mean ensuring they don’t advise on tax evasion or other illegal activities. For a financial advisory firm, it means scrutinizing their investment products and strategies to ensure they align with Sharia.
-
Privacy and Data Security:
- What to look for: How is personal and financial data handled? Is it protected from breaches? Is it sold to third parties without consent? Is there a clear, accessible privacy policy?
- Islamic Principle: Emphasizes the protection of privacy and trust amanah in handling sensitive information.
- Relevant Law: The General Data Protection Regulation GDPR in Europe and various state laws in the US like CCPA in California enforce strict data privacy standards.
-
Social Responsibility:
- What to look for: Does the company contribute positively to society? Does it avoid activities that harm the environment or community? Does it engage in corporate social responsibility initiatives?
- Islamic Principle: Encourages businesses to be socially responsible, contribute to community well-being, and practice ethical governance.
